What is the violent crime rate in Brownwood?

The estimated violent crime rate in Brownwood is 214.7 per 100,000 residents, which is 44% lower than the national average. This means residents have roughly a 1 in 466 chance of becoming a violent crime victim each year. Key violent crime rates include: murder at 2.3 per 100K (54% below average); aggravated assault at 150.5 per 100K (44% below average); robbery at 42.3 per 100K (43% below average).

What is the property crime rate in Brownwood?

The estimated property crime rate in Brownwood is 851.8 per 100,000 residents, which is 54% lower than the national average. Residents have roughly a 1 in 117 chance of being a property crime victim per year. Key property crime rates include: burglary at 139.3 per 100K (48% below average); larceny/theft at 587.3 per 100K (58% below average); vehicle theft at 125.2 per 100K (61% below average).
